The Offshore Trade-Off

Here’s the honest take: Fortune Clock is not regulated by the UK Gambling Commission. It holds a Curacao eGaming licence, which means UK consumer protections like the dispute resolution service and mandatory GAMSTOP reporting do not apply. The site does not report to GAMSTOP, though you can contact support to request account closure or self-exclusion. That’s a voluntary step, not an automatic one. If you value strong regulatory oversight, this is a red flag. If you’re comfortable with offshore casinos and just want a big game selection with a generous bonus, the trade-off might be acceptable – as long as you know what you’re walking into.
